Java 将 Html 代码视为网页

标签 java html

我有一个 HTML 代码,我想在 jeditorpane 中查看网页,但我做不到。

html 代码:http://pastebin.com/S0TEGrH5

我的尝试:

jEditorPane2.setContentType("text/html");

jEditorPane2.setText(htmlcode);

在这个过程之后,我只听到 dıtt 和屏幕是空的。如果我将这段代码保存为文件 (file.html) 和 jeditorpane2.setpage("file.html") 过程成功了。但我没有想创建文件请建议查看 html 代码,因为网页只使用代码,不创建文件)

最佳答案

您的问题与字符集有关。

在 setText 之前你应该添加这段代码:

jEditorPane2.getDocument().putProperty("IgnoreCharsetDirective", Boolean.TRUE);

关于Java 将 Html 代码视为网页,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18803127/

相关文章:

javascript - 如何在 javascript 或 jquery 中显示/向下滑动相关单选按钮

javascript - 使用外部数据库在多个站点上更新 html 和 css

html - 表格列宽不被尊重

java - 制作一个健壮的、可调整大小的 Swing 棋图形用户界面

java - 如何在不依赖方法的情况下删除链表末尾的节点?

java - 霍夫曼代码将位写入文件以进行压缩

php - 它没有处理 php 代码,而是将其显示为注释

java - Jsoup, '>' 的问题相关转换

java - 测试 java.time API

java - Spring-AOP 切入点不起作用?